DescriptionMap of portions of Litchfield County and Hartford County, showing the watershed of the Nepaug Reservoir. Tracks of the New York, New Haven and Hartford Railroad are at the right. The East Brank Reservoir and Greenwood Pond are at the upper right. The Nepaug Reservoir, Nepaug Dam, Phelps Brook Dam, and East Dike are at the lower right. Roads are shown but not identified. Names of property owners are indicated in pencil and red ink. Some names are crossed out.
